다음을 통해 공유


작은 메모리 덤프

작은 메모리 덤프는 다른 두 종류의 커널 모드 크래시 덤프 파일보다 훨씬 작습니다. 정확히 64KB 크기이며 부팅 드라이브에 64KB의 페이지 파일 공간만 필요합니다.

이 덤프 파일에는 다음이 포함됩니다.

  • 버그 검사 메시지 및 매개 변수뿐만 아니라 다른 블루 스크린 데이터도 있습니다.

  • 충돌한 프로세서의 프로세서 컨텍스트(PRCB)입니다.

  • 충돌한 프로세스에 대한 EPROCESS(프로세스 정보 및 커널 컨텍스트)입니다.

  • 충돌한 스레드에 대한 스레드 정보 및 커널 컨텍스트(ETHREAD)입니다.

  • 충돌한 스레드에 대한 커널 모드 호출 스택입니다. 이 값이 16KB보다 긴 경우 최상위 16KB만 포함됩니다.

  • 로드된 드라이버 목록입니다.

Windows XP 이상 버전의 Windows에서는 다음 항목도 포함됩니다.

  • 로드된 모듈 및 언로드된 모듈 목록입니다.

  • 디버거 데이터 블록입니다. 여기에는 시스템에 대한 기본 디버깅 정보가 포함됩니다.

  • Windows가 디버깅 실패에 유용하다고 식별하는 추가 메모리 페이지입니다. 여기에는 충돌이 발생했을 때 레지스터가 가리키는 데이터 페이지와 오류 구성 요소에서 특별히 요청한 기타 페이지가 포함됩니다.

  • (Windows Server 2003 이상) Windows SKU(예: "Professional" 또는 "Server").

이러한 종류의 덤프 파일은 공간이 크게 제한될 때 유용할 수 있습니다. 그러나 포함된 정보의 양이 제한되어 있으므로 크래시 시 실행 중인 스레드로 인해 직접 발생하지 않은 오류는 이 파일의 분석에 의해 검색되지 않을 수 있습니다.

이러한 종류의 덤프 파일에는 크래시 당시 메모리에 있는 실행 파일의 이미지가 포함되어 있지 않으므로 이러한 실행 파일이 중요한 것으로 판명될 경우 실행 파일 이미지 경로를 설정해야 할 수도 있습니다.

두 번째 버그 검사 발생하고 두 번째 작은 메모리 덤프 파일이 만들어지면 이전 파일이 유지됩니다. 각 추가 파일에는 파일 이름으로 인코딩된 크래시 날짜가 포함된 고유한 이름이 지정됩니다. 예를 들어 mini022900-01.dmp는 2000년 2월 29일에 생성된 첫 번째 메모리 덤프 파일입니다. 모든 작은 메모리 덤프 파일 목록은 %SystemRoot%\Minidump 디렉터리에 유지됩니다.

참고 항목

Kernel-Mode 덤프 파일의 종류